Ukrainian President Dismisses Air Force Chief After Tragic F-16 Incident

 August 30, 2024

In a significant shake-up within the Ukrainian military, President Volodymyr Zelensky has dismissed the country's air force commander, Lt. Gen. Mykola Oleshchuk.

The removal follows a tragic accident involving an F-16 fighter jet, claiming the life of a prominent pilot during ongoing Russian bombardments, the New York Post reported.

This drastic decision came shortly after the death of distinguished pilot Oleksiy Mes, known by his call sign "Moonfish," after his F-16 fighter crashed. The jet's crash coincides with a heightening of hostilities, including a Russian attack that severely impacted the city of Kharkiv.

Oleksiy Mes was one of the few Ukrainian pilots adept in operating the recently acquired F-16s from NATO. The cause of the crash is under investigation, with theories ranging from friendly fire by a Patriot missile to potential mechanical failure or pilot error.

Investigation Underway With US Assistance

As the circumstances of the crash remain uncertain, US experts have joined the probe, indicating the seriousness of the incident and its implications for Ukraine's air defense capabilities. These F-16 jets represent a significant upgrade for Ukraine's military, poised to play a crucial role in the ongoing conflict.

During the same period, Russian forces executed a brutal attack on Kharkiv using glide bombs. This assault resulted in tragic casualties, including the death of a 14-year-old girl named Sofia and injuries to nearly fifty others.

President Zelensky's response to these events has been to call for an increase in military strength and better protection of personnel. He emphasized the need for international support to enhance Ukraine's defensive posture against Russian advances.
